How Do You Do Generative Digital Art?

Art|Digital Art

Generative digital art is an exciting and evolving form of artwork that uses computer algorithms to create unique visuals. It is a type of algorithmic art that uses mathematical formulas to create abstract shapes, patterns, and textures. Generative artists use software and coding to design pieces that are visually stimulating and thought-provoking.

Generative digital art is created by using programming languages such as Processing, OpenFrameworks, and C++. These languages are used to write code that will generate visuals based on the parameters given by the artist.

The artist sets up the parameters in the code, but the visuals created by the program are often unpredictable and ever-changing. This allows for a great deal of creative freedom for the artist to explore new ideas and concepts.

The possibilities for generative digital art are practically endless; from graphic designs, 3D models, animations, interactive visuals, soundscapes, and more. Generative artwork can also be used to create generative music or video games. Some artists even use generative techniques to create virtual reality experiences or augmented reality experiences.

The most important thing for aspiring generative digital artists is to be constantly experimenting with different coding languages and software tools. By exploring different ways of coding and manipulating data through algorithms, artists can learn how to use these tools in order to create unique visual experiences. Additionally, it’s important for generative digital artists to stay up-to-date with current trends in technology as these technologies will often influence the way they create their artwork.

Conclusion:

Generative digital art is an exciting form of art that uses computer algorithms to generate complex visuals from simple instructions given by the artist. To become a successful generative digital artist it is important to stay up-to-date with current trends in technology as well as be constantly experimenting with different coding languages and software tools in order to create unique visuals.